What are the responsibilities and job description for the Civil CAD Drafter position at PDDM Workforce?
As a CAD Designer you'll be working with project teams that create plan sets and deliverables for our diverse clients. We are involved in many of today’s most successful market sectors including energy development, commercial and residential development, healthcare, industrial and public sector markets. You will work from detailed sketches and verbal or written direction to produce computer-generated models, plans, base maps, profiles, cross-sections, details, figures, overlays and simple isometric drawings. 2 years' experience.
- Provide AutoCAD design support for various Civil Engineering and Construction projects
- Prepare and label preliminary layouts and detailed design drawings from engineering notes, sketches, and/or other drawings
- Work directly with project engineers to learn design skills for a variety of projects
- Opportunity to work in an innovative environment
Skills and Qualifications:
- High School Diploma required.
- Associate degree with related AutoCAD experience preferred
- Certificate in an AutoCAD related training course or work equivalent
- 2-5 years of related AutoCAD experience
- Understanding of creation and compilation of construction drawings using AutoCAD or Civil3D
- High proficiency in Microsoft Office (Outlook, Word, Excel, etc.)
- Capability to work independently and as a team player
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ills are required
- AutoCAD/Civil 3D training and/or relative experience.
- Attention to detail
- Ability to speak and write professionally.
